NHTSA Campaign Id 86V081000; Date: Jun. 23, 1986
1981 Chevrolet C70; 1982 Chevrolet C70; 1983 Chevrolet C70; 1984 Chevrolet C70; 1985 Chevrolet C70; 1981 GMC C70; 1982 GMC C70; 1983 GMC C70; 1984 GMC C70; 1985 GMC C70
Component: Steering:linkages:arm:idler And Attachment
Manufactured by: General Motors Corp.
Affected Units:: 499
Steering control arm can be overstressed with heavy steering input causing it to crack and it could eventually break completely. Consequence of defect: if the steering control arm breaks, complete loss of steering ability and truck control would occur without warning which could result in an accident.
Install new steering arm and other steering system hardware which will prevent overstressing input conditions from occurring.
System: steering control arm. Vehicle description: medium duty conventional trucks equipped with 9,000 or 12,000 lb. Front driving steering axle and an 8. 2 liter engine.
Date Owners notified by Manufacturer: Aug 21, 1986
